Skip to main content

Hur väljer jag den bästa applikationsservern för öppen källkod?

En applikationsserver med öppen källkod görs för att arbeta med värdprogram, och att välja rätt applikationsserver kan hjälpa ett företag och dess online -närvaro.En applikationsserver med öppen källkod görs för att vara värd för en applikation, så den måste vanligtvis veta vanliga programmeringsspråk för att säkerställa att applikationen fungerar korrekt.När applikationsservern kommer åt en databas är det möjligt för redundant information att bromsa processer och en redundanscheck kan hjälpa till att optimera programmet.Många hackare försöker komma igenom ett system via en applikationsserver, så effektiv säkerhet krävs normalt.Även om applikationsservern Open Source kan vara lika bra som en som byggs av ett etablerat företag, kan det också finnas kvalitetsproblem att oroa sig för.

När en applikation är värd på en open source -applikationsserver, kommer servern vanligtvis att behöva förstå denspråk som används för att bygga applikationen.Till exempel, om programmeringsspråket är okänt för servern, kan vissa funktioner saknas, applikationen kan krascha under användning eller den kan aldrig starta.Vissa applikationsservrar gör det möjligt för användare att lägga till nya programmeringsspråk genom nedladdningar, men detta är ovanligt, så användare bör välja applikationsservrar som har det språk de oftast använder.

Under applikationens användning är det vanligt att servern får åtkomst till databasen, antingen för att dra information eller lagra den.Om applikationsservern Open Source inte har en Redundancy Checker -funktion kan detta bromsa driften.Till exempel, om information läggs till i databasen som är densamma som tidigare lagrad information, kan detta lägga till extra vikt till databasen som inte krävs.Bortsett från att påverka databasens hastighet kan detta också påverka applikationen.

Användare är vanligtvis tillåtna grundläggande åtkomst till applikationsservern Open Source, så detta gör det lite enklare för hackare att komma igenom systemet.Detta innebär att det vanligtvis krävs att få en applikationsserver med något skydd.De flesta applikationsservrar har grundläggande säkerhetsverktyg, men avancerade verktyg kan vara bättre för att hindra hackare från att bryta igenom servern.

Som ett open source -program kan en applikationsserver med öppen källkod ha programmeringsbrister som de flesta stängda källprogram inte har.Detta beror på att människor som är intresserade av att skapa en applikationsserver mdash;inte ett företag som vill sälja serverprogrammet till allmänheten mdash;Bygg de flesta open source -program.Användare bör leka med servern för att kontrollera om de är fel innan de väljer ett applikationsserverprogram att stanna hos.